Abstract

The invention discloses a lightening power consumption management system for underground garages. The system comprises a power consumption management device arranged in an underground garage power consumption management room, a plurality of garage power consumption managers arranged in driver houses respectively and a plurality of vehicle power consumption management extensions arranged in a plurality of garage inlet management rooms of a management garage respectively, wherein the plurality of the garage power consumption managers and the plurality of the vehicle power consumption management extensions communicate with the power consumption management device; the power consumption management device comprises a power consumption master controller, a driveway lightening control circuit and a parking space control circuit; each of the garage power consumption managers comprises a power consumption sub-controller and a parking space number input unit; and each of the vehicle power consumption management extensions comprises an entrance guard card identification unit, a parking space information storage unit, a garage information manager, a display unit, a parameter setting unit and a clock circuit. By means of the lightening power consumption management system, the circuit design is reasonable, the wiring is convenient, the usage operation is simple and convenient, the intelligent degree is high, the utilization effect is good, and power consumption can be managed automatically according to actual lightening requirements.

Background technology
Along with the continuous increase of city automobile recoverable amount, parking difficulty problem has become a universal phenomenon of large-and-medium size cities, thereby nearly all newly-built building all has underground garage at present, and underground garage has been alleviated the practical problems of parking difficulty on the ground largely.But, due to the problem of dull thread irradiation of the long-term four seasons of underground garage, thereby a large amount of lightings must be set, and must be equipped with large quantities of garage managerial personnel thereupon.Nowadays, the lighting that underground garage adopts, be all no matter to have or not in lighting demand one day 24 hours all in on-state conventionally, thereby power consumption is quite large, especially, for Large Underground Parking Space, has great electricity consumption wasting of resources problem.Thereby, lack at present a kind of circuit design rationally, easy-to-connect, use is easy and simple to handle and intelligent degree is high, result of use is good underground garage lighting power consuming administrative system, it can carry out the management of power use automatically according to actual illumination demand, has significantly reduced electricity consumption wastage.
